The OP Stack: A Foundation for Scalable AI Infrastructure

The OP Stack, developed by Optimism, provides a modular framework for creating Ethereum-compatible L2 solutions. It enables developers to build rollups that inherit Ethereum's security while offering enhanced scalability and reduced transaction costs. For AI applications, this means the ability to process high volumes of transactions and data without the bottlenecks associated with Ethereum's mainnet.

OpenLedger leverages the OP Stack to facilitate high throughput and low-latency execution of AI models. By settling transactions on the Ethereum mainnet, it ensures the integrity and security of operations, making it suitable for enterprise-grade AI applications.

EigenDA: Ensuring Data Availability for AI Workloads

AI workloads are inherently data-intensive, requiring vast amounts of information for training and inference. Traditional data storage solutions may not meet the scalability and cost-effectiveness needed for such operations.

EigenDA, a decentralized data availability solution, addresses this by providing a scalable and verifiable method for storing and accessing large datasets. It ensures that data is readily available for AI computations while maintaining integrity and reducing storage costs.

In the context of OpenLedger, EigenDA serves as the backbone for data storage, enabling the platform to handle the extensive data requirements of AI applications efficiently.

On-Chain AI: A Transparent and Verifiable Ecosystem

OpenLedger's architecture supports the deployment of AI models directly on-chain, ensuring transparency and accountability. Every action from dataset uploads to model training and inference is recorded on the blockchain, creating an immutable ledger of activities.

This on-chain approach facilitates several key benefits:

Data Attribution: Utilizing a Proof of Attribution (PoA) system, OpenLedger tracks contributions from data providers, model developers, and other stakeholders, ensuring fair compensation and recognition.

Governance: The community can participate in governance decisions, influencing the development and evolution of AI models and datasets.

Interoperability: With Ethereum compatibility, OpenLedger allows seamless integration with existing DeFi protocols and other blockchain-based applications.

Tokenomics and Incentives: Aligning Stakeholders

The $OPEN token is central to OpenLedger's ecosystem, serving multiple purposes:

Transaction Fees: Users pay for operations such as model training and data storage.

Staking: Validators and participants can stake $OPEN tokens to secure the network and earn rewards.

Governance: Token holders have voting rights on protocol upgrades and other significant decisions.

This tokenomics model ensures that all participants have a vested interest in the platform's success, promoting a sustainable and collaborative ecosystem.
